Welcome to Time Out

Time Out is a vibrant arcade and bar located in Ames, Iowa, known for its impressive mix of retro games and lively atmosphere. This locally owned gem features a dedicated Star Wars room, modern pinball machines, and a variety of classic arcade games. Patrons can enjoy entertaining karaoke nights, themed events like music bingo, and creative drinks, all enveloped in nostalgic 80s and 90s decor. With affordable food options and a welcoming ambiance, Time Out caters to gamers and music lovers alike, making it a must-visit destination for anyone seeking fun, creativity, and a touch of nostalgia in their nightlife experience.

The front side of the bar has darts and karaoke, lots of seating and a huge bar. The beer selection and drinks are great. They also do cool events like music bingo and Bob Ross painting night. The back is an 80's/90's arcade with retro video games, skee ball, pool table, pop a shot and modern pinball machines. They have app style food that fixed fresh when it's ordered and tasty. There are tv's everywhere that are showing the Gen X videos that correspond to the music you're hearing, or they have a classic movie on (Ghostbusters, Goonies, etc...). This is a really fun, locally owned business!
